Output 3a5422de12831467b9bcdd7d9ea14bc936c571cdf2eaaeabfeac31e021e31ee4:1

value
134615812
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d25312150a32230b9c7bea3289a908108703b226 OP_EQUAL
address
3Ls7LgDWHgte1wHwMb6LQLc269UbEMcmKa
transaction
3a5422de12831467b9bcdd7d9ea14bc936c571cdf2eaaeabfeac31e021e31ee4
confirmations
245200
spent
true